Croatia food

Croatian food reflects a mix of Mediterranean, Italian, Austro‑Hungarian, and Balkan influences, with clear differences between the coastal and inland regions. Along the Adriatic, seafood, olive oil, and grilled fish are central, while inland cooking focuses on meats, stews, sausages, and baked dishes. Well‑known specialities include čobanac (a spicy Slavonian meat stew), purica s mlincima (roast turkey with flat baked dough sheets called mlinci), pašticada (a slow‑cooked Dalmatian beef stew), and sarma (stuffed cabbage rolls).
